Transaction

3042c7b38d2ea9c5004bf6cdcbbe7b9e37673226ecf1af886433bf0056925f9d

Summary

In Block431841
TimeTue, 07 Nov 2023 17:40:30 UTC
Total Input2152.80229004 Nebula
Total Output2152.80222644 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
455526 Confirmations2152.80222644 Nebula
Raw Transaction